Understanding Real-World Evidence (RWE) in the Regulatory Landscape

The FDA defines RWE as the clinical evidence regarding the usage and potential benefits or risks of a medical product derived from analysis of real-world data (RWD). RWD refers to data collected outside of traditional clinical trials, such as data from electronic health records, insurance claims, and patient registries.

As the FDA encourages

the integration of RWE into product evaluations through initiatives like the 21st Century Cures Act, professionals in the pharmaceutical and medtech sectors must comprehend the specific methodologies needed to generate regulatory-grade RWE. The credibility of such evidence hinges on robust study design and methodology, including elements like target trial emulation and the use of propensity scores.

Key Components of RWE Study Design Methodology

When formulating an RWE study, it is critical to employ a structured methodology that ensures the findings can withstand regulatory scrutiny. Below are fundamental components that should be included in your RWE study design.

1. Define the Research Question

Every successful RWE study begins with a clearly defined research question. This question should align with regulatory goals and provide insights that add value to the current understanding of a product’s effectiveness or safety profile. Engage KOLs early in this stage to ensure that the research question resonates with clinical realities.

2. Select Appropriate Real-World Data Sources

Identifying and selecting appropriate sources of RWD is vital. Available options include:

  • Electronic health records (EHRs)
  • Claims databases
  • Patient registries
  • Wearable technology and mobile health apps

Consideration must be given to the validity and relevance of the data sources chosen. Evaluating data integrity, completeness, and applicability to the population of interest is critical for ensuring your findings will be accepted by regulators.

3. Target Trial Emulation

Target trial emulation is a methodology used to design observational studies that closely resemble randomized controlled trials. It provides a novel approach to situating RWE studies within a framework that regulators find familiar and acceptable. Key aspects include:

  • Defining inclusion and exclusion criteria that reflect the intended trial population.
  • Defining relevant outcome measures and appropriate timing for assessments.
  • Choosing suitable control groups, which may include external control arms.

This approach provides a foundation for addressing biases common in observational studies, thereby increasing the regulatory robustness of your evidence.

4. Addressing Confounding Control

Confounding bias can severely impact the validity of RWE. Employing statistical methods to control for confounding variables is crucial. Some techniques include:

  • Propensity score matching
  • Stratification by confounders
  • Regression modeling

Using these techniques in consultation with biostatisticians will strengthen your analysis. It is essential to recognize which confounding factors are likely to exist in your data set and to create strategies for mitigating their effects.

5. Statistical Analysis Plan

A detailed statistical analysis plan (SAP) should be crafted, outlining the proposed methods of analysis that align with FDA guidance on RWE submissions. This should include:

  • Descriptive statistics for baseline characteristics
  • Analytic methods for assessing outcomes
  • Methods for handling missing data

By collaborating closely with statisticians, you can refine the SAP to ensure compliance with regulatory expectations.

6. Engaging with Regulatory Authorities

Regular engagement with the FDA or other relevant regulatory authorities throughout the study design and development phase is essential. This can be achieved through:

  • Pre-Submission consultations
  • Participating in public meetings or workshops
  • Utilizing the FDA’s guidance on RWE for best practices

These interactions not only provide a platform to clarify regulatory expectations but also build rapport and credibility with regulators.

Collaborating with Key Opinion Leaders (KOLs) and Statisticians

Partnering with KOLs and expert statisticians during RWE study design enhances the rigor and credibility of findings. KOLs offer insights on clinical relevance and can advocate for the importance of the research within the medical community.

1. Identifying and Engaging KOLs

Identifying the right KOLs who are experts in the therapeutic area of study is paramount. Engaging with them begins with:

  • Conducting thorough background research to understand their work and influence.
  • Approaching them with a focused agenda that outlines the potential impact of the RWE study.

Encourage KOLs to participate in the design phase, providing them with opportunities to contribute to the development of research questions, methodology, and interpretation of findings.

2. Collaborating with Statisticians

Statistics play a pivotal role in ensuring the integrity and reliability of RWE studies. Collaboration should center around:

  • Defining the statistical methods during study design to mitigate bias.
  • Calculation of sample sizes to ensure adequate power is maintained.
  • Establishment of data analysis protocols in accordance with regulatory standards.

Engaging statisticians early in the process allows for the alignment of methodologies with modern statistical advancements, which helps bolster your submission’s credibility.

Submission Considerations for RWE Studies

Crafting a successful submission to the FDA using RWE involves meticulous documentation and adherence to established guidelines. Key consideration should be given to:

1. Structuring the Submission

Submissions should follow the standard formats outlined in FDA 21 CFR Parts 312 and 314 for new drug applications and biologics license applications, respectively. Specific sections that may relate directly to RWE include:

  • Clinical Study Reports: Detail your study methodology, including statistical analyses and real-world applicability.
  • Integrated Summaries of Safety and Efficacy: Include findings from RWE and their contribution to understanding the product’s risk-benefit profile.

2. Addressing FDA’s RWE Framework

The FDA’s Framework for the Regulatory Use of Real-World Evidence offers directional insights into evaluating RWE. It is advisable to incorporate elements of this framework into your documentation, particularly in sections that describe the RWD sources, study design, and analytical methods used.

3. Engaging in Post-Submission Communication

Once the submission is made, maintaining lines of communication with the FDA is essential. Be prepared for possible queries regarding methodology and findings, and ensure that you can provide clarifications or additional data should it be requested.
